【Sail】项目第一天简介和环境搭建
2017-11-09 15:34
169 查看
概述
最近一段时间都在使用springboot进行开发,很是方便,之前用过spring框架应该很快能上手,在某天看到一篇文章收获很大,说是技术的分享对于自己的提升帮助是很大的,一方面加深了自己的理解,记忆,另一方面查漏补缺,把不懂的细节重新看一遍。这里从零开始搭建一套后台系统,加深自己的记忆,也希望能帮助更多初学者。目前只打算整合springboot+springMVC+Mybatis-Plus+shiro+redis以后有新想法再加吧
工具我用的是Idea 当然也推荐使用STS,看个人习惯,环境是jdk1.8 到时会把源码上传到git。环境搭建
偷懒(哈哈)直接在 http://start.spring.io/ ,也可以直接用Idea的Spring Initializr工具快速搭建一个springboot项目 都是基于官方web构建的。这里把你的项目基本信息和springboot的版本选好后直接点Generate Project 下载到本地,再导入到Idea中。整个项目的结构图如下
和普通的web项目没什么大的区别,建好项目会自动生成一个SailApplication.java启动类,我们可以直接运行这个main方面就是启动了服务,但是目前我们没加什么模块,也看不出什么效果,我们测试一下
在pom文件中加上web模块依赖
<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Id> </dependency>
SailApplicaltion根目录下新建一个Controller包,新建一个测试controller
我们打开浏览器输入http://localhost:8080/hello
成功!完美!~~~~ 下一篇将把我们要用到的模块依赖都添加进来,以及简单的配置
另外建了个交流群,有不明白的朋友方便交流454866514
相关文章推荐
- 电商项目实战——第一天(环境部署)3搭建vsftpd服务器
- 电商项目实战——第一天(环境部署)4搭建Nginx,域名解析配置
- sap ui5教程(0)简介、环境搭建、创建项目
- Microsoft NLayerApp“.NET研究”案例理论与实践 - 项目简介与环境搭建
- 木瓜妮子多媒体开发教程---第一天---Android环境搭建和Helloworld项目测试
- Microsoft NLayerApp案例理论与实践 - 项目简介与环境搭建
- 电商项目实战——第一天(环境部署)3搭建vsftpd服务器
- 人事管理项目第一天之开发环境搭建
- Num60 (p2p项目简介,环境搭建,angularjs)
- 宅急送 项目第一天 环境搭建
- 第一天-Java语言简介,环境搭建等
- 一起谈.NET技术,Microsoft NLayerApp案例理论与实践 - 项目简介与环境搭建
- Nginx+Gunicorn+Supervisor 搭建 Django 项目环境
- Redis入门很简单之一【简介与环境搭建】
- OA项目1:环境搭建之数据库创建与环境添加
- MAVEN环境搭建和IDEA创建MAVEN项目
- ionic2 -- 环境搭建和ionic2项目目录介绍
- Android基础之用Eclipse搭建Android开发环境和创建第一个Android项目(Windows平台)
- JBoss环境搭建及部署Web项目
- IOS博客项目搭建-01-项目基本环境部署